101 Views The scraggly cherry blossom tree known as Stumpy on March 15 in Washington, D.C. At high tide, the…
Read More101 Views The scraggly cherry blossom tree known as Stumpy on March 15 in Washington, D.C. At high tide, the…
Read More14 Views If humanoid robots make you a bit queasy — would it help if they had fleshy faces that…
Read More